Book Description

December 28, 1996 0415128889 978-0415128889
This handbook discusses some of the ways in which psychological research and methods can be applied by a wide variety of professional groups working with offenders. It concentrates on the assessment of risk in forensic settings and the interventions designed to reduce risk in violent and sexual offenders, and is divided into three sections. The first section includes an overview of major psychological perspectives on offending and this is followed by chapters on the contribution of psychological development and offender profiling. Section two focuses on the assessment of risk with particular emphasis given to two examples - the assessment of risk of suicidal behaviour and violence. Section three looks at the application of psychological assessment and intervention approaches. The focus throughout this section is on the use of systematic approaches to assessment and intervention and the two areas discussed in detail are anger management difficulties and sexual offending.

About the Author

Graham Towl is Head of Forensic Psychology for the East Anglia area of the Prison Service. He is visiting scholar at the University of Cambridge and is on the board of examiners for the MSc in Applied Criminological Psychology at Birkbeck College, University of London. He has previously worked in psychiatric hospitals.
David Crighton is Forensic Psychologist at the Yorkshire Centre for Forensic Psychiatry and is a member of the board of examiners for the University of London MSc in Applied Criminological Psychology. He has previously worked in psychiatric hospitals. --This text refers to the Hardcover edition.
